Three-Loop Electroweak Correction to the Rho Parameter in the Large Higgs Mass Limit

Abstract

We present an analytical calculation of the leading three-loop radiative correction to the rho-parameter in the Standard Model in the large Higgs mass limit. This correction, of order g^6 m_H^4/M_W^4, is opposite in sign to the leading two-loop correction of order g^4 m_H^2/M_W^2. The two corrections cancel each other for a Higgs mass of approximately 480 GeV. The result shows that it is extremely unlikely that a strongly interacting Higgs sector could fit the data of electroweak precision measurements.
